The Anatomy of the Super 8 Table
Decoding the T20 World Cup 2026 Super 8 table requires understanding its specific structure. Points are the primary currency, with two points for a win and one for a no result. When teams are level on points, the net run rate (NRR) becomes the first tiebreaker. This mathematical chase for a superior NRR often leads to aggressive batting and strategic bowling changes, adding a thrilling layer to the contest.
Key Factors Influencing the Standings
Win-Loss Record: The fundamental basis for ranking, determining direct qualification or elimination.
Net Run Rate (NRR): A crucial statistical tool that balances runs scored against runs conceded, often deciding progression in tight scenarios.
Head-to-Head Record: The direct encounter results between tied teams serve as the next tie-breaking mechanism.
Bonus Points: Some formats award points for winning within a certain number of overs, encouraging proactive play.
